Abstract

This research explores the recent Human Resources (HR) management trends within the Information Technology (IT) sector. The IT industry, known for its dynamic and rapidly evolving nature, presents unique challenges and opportunities for HR professionals. This study will examine key trends such as remote work, diversity and inclusion, employee well-being, upskilling and reskilling, and adopting advanced HR technologies like AI and data analytics. By analyzing these trends, the research will provide insights into how HR practices adapt to meet the demands of the modern IT workforce and propose strategies for organizations to enhance their HR functions effectively.
